How to fix Microsoft office error code 0x2-0x0 in Windows?
Microsoft Office, which includes software like Word, Excel, and PowerPoint, is a core productivity package available to Windows 10 and Windows 11 users. It offers users tools to edit documents, analyze data, and present. Whether through a Microsoft 365 subscription or a stand-alone purchase like Office 2024, it is widely used for personal and business use, relying on smooth activation and licensing to function. However, users can encounter issues like the 0x2-0x0 error code, which halts the activation process and prevents users from accessing Office programs.
The 0x2-0x0 error most often occurs while activating Microsoft Office, typically with a Sorry, something went wrong message, following the entry of a product key or the logon to a Microsoft account. Those affected can't open Office apps, with some getting a Product Deactivated message despite having a valid license. Others reported getting this error code 0x2-0x0 after installing a Windows update or when switching between Microsoft 365 plans, with one user reporting it persisted even after re-installing Office.
This is a common error related to activation issues, e.g., problems with the Office Licensing Service, which validates your license on Microsoft servers. The reasons are possibly corrupted license data, networking issues preventing connectivity to activation servers, or conflicts from third-party applications such as antivirus programs. Corrupted Windows files, prior Office installations, or regional setting mismatches are also possible causes.
There are a few troubleshooting steps that can repair the 0x2-0x0 error, such as fixing Office, clearing licensing data, or having accurate network connectivity. The following are eight step-by-step solutions to activate Microsoft Office and have it back to its usual condition.

Fix 1. Update Windows
Microsoft frequently resolves bugs linked to numerous concerns, so make sure you update Windows to the most recent version to guarantee that all bug solutions are applied.
- In Windows search, type Updates and hit Enter.
- In the new window, click Check for updates and wait till everything is installed.
- Make sure you also install any available optional updates.
- When done, restart your system to implement the changes.
Fix 2. Check network connectivity
The 0x2-0x0 error can occur if Office cannot connect to Microsoft’s activation servers due to network issues. Verifying your connection ensures a stable activation process.
Windows 11
- Type Troubleshoot in Windows search and hit Enter.
- Select Other troubleshooters.
- Locate Network & Internet troubleshooter from the list and click Run.
- Wait till the process is finished and apply the recommended fixes.
- Restart your device.
Windows 10
- Right-click on Start and pick Settings.
- Go to the Network & Internet section.
- On the right side, find the Advanced network settings section.
- Click Network troubleshooter and wait.
- The fixes will be automatically applied.
Fix 3. Repair Office
Corrupted Office files can cause activation failures, leading to errors like 0x2-0x0. Repairing the installation can fix these issues without affecting your data.
- Type Control Panel in Windows search and press Enter.
- Select Programs > Programs and Features.
- Select Microsoft Office and click on Change.
- Choose the option for Online Repair and click Repair.
- Follow the prompts to finish the process.
Fix 4. Update Office to the latest version
An outdated Office installation might have bugs that cause activation errors. Updating ensures you have the latest fixes for licensing issues.
- Open any Office app, such as Microsoft Word.
- Click on the File tab in the top-left corner.
- Select Account from the menu.
- Under the Product Information section, click on Update Options.
- Choose Update Now to check for and install any available updates.
- Restart the Office application after the update is complete to see if the issue is resolved.
Fix 5. Clear Office cache data
Corrupted licensing data can prevent Office from activating properly. Clearing this data forces Office to revalidate your license.
- In Windows search, type %localappdata%\Microsoft\Office\16.0\OfficeFileCache and press Enter to navigate to the OfficeFileCache folder.
- Delete all files within the OfficeFileCache folder – press Shift Del for quick action.
- After clearing the cache, restart your computer and attempt the Office installation again.
Fix 6. Use Microsoft Support and Recovery Assistant
This free tool from Microsoft can help people to resolve various issues with Office apps.
- Open your browser and go to the official Microsoft support website.
- Scroll down and click Download under Uninstall and reinstall Office.
- Once downloaded, double-click SetupProd_OffScrub.exe to launch it.
- When prompted, click Install.
- Once installed, launch Microsoft Support and Recovery Assistant.
- Select Office & Office Apps and click Next.
- Next, choose I have Office 365 subscription, but I'm having trouble installing it (or another appropriate option) option and click Next.
- Click Yes to begin a scan.
- Follow instructions after the scan is finished.
Fix 7. Disable third-party antivirus
Third-party antivirus software can block Office from communicating with activation servers. Temporarily disabling it can help.
- Open your antivirus program and disable real-time protection temporarily.
- If using a firewall, turn it off temporarily in Settings > Privacy & Security > Windows Security > Firewall & Network Protection.
- Retry the installation, and re-enable security settings after completing the process.
Fix 8. Reinstall Office
If the Office installation is severely corrupted, it might fail to activate properly. Reinstalling it ensures a fresh setup of all components.
- Right-click on Start and pick Apps and Features/Installed apps.
- Scroll down to find the MS Office installation.
- Click Uninstall and confirm with Uninstall.
- Follow on-screen instructions to remove the app completely.
- Press Win E to open File Explorer.
- Navigate to the following location and delete its contents:
C:\Program Files\Microsoft Office - Next, type regedit in Windows search and press Enter.
- Go to the following locations in the Registry Editor and delete these items:
Computer\H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\AppVISV
Computer\H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Office\ClickToRun
Computer\H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Office - Reboot your device and then reinstall Microsoft Office.
